IK Investment Partners to acquire A-Katsastus Group’s operations in Sweden, Poland and the Baltics

June 04, 2018 Banking and Finance

Vinge has advised IK Small Cap II Fund in connection with entering into an agreement to acquire Carspect AB, SIA Scantest, Autotest Polska Sp. Z.o.o and A-Ülevaatus OÜ (“the Group”), from A-Katsastus Group Oy, a leading provider of vehicle inspection services in Northern Europe.

Completion of the transaction is subject to customary conditions.

Vinge’s team consisted of, among others, partner Jonas Bergström together with associates Johanna Wiberg, Michaela Cronemyrand Karolina Cohrs (M&A), partner Louise Brorson Salomon together with associate Lionardo Ojeda (financing).
